Core Sanctuary

The first threshold of the Dharana Protocol™. Restorative Sanctuaries of 40m² within a nature-positive estate in Montefollonico, Tuscany. Sixteen exist.

Interior of a 65m² Sovereign Sanctuary at Agaporia opening onto the Tuscan landscape through expanded glazing, with reclaimed chestnut surfaces and lime-plaster walls.

Private Shelter

The wider threshold of the Dharana Protocol™. Restorative Sanctuaries of 65m². The boundary with the landscape is porous. Six exist.

Interior of an 80m² Master Residency at Agaporia opening onto the infinite cadence of the Tuscan hills, with multi-chambered architectural volumes and reclaimed natural materials.

Master Residency

The summit of the Dharana Protocol™. Restorative Sanctuaries of 80m², opening onto the cadence of the Tuscan hills. Two exist.

Regenerative Design

Hemp, lime, straw, sandstone, clay and mycelium. Everything in these walls was alive, or was already on this hillside.

One season ago part of your room was standing in a field. What is around you now is half a metre thick, warm to the hand in winter and cool through August.

Sound goes into the wall and does not come back. What is left in your room is the stillness you have been looking for.
